Larsen: Move by Move by Cyrus Lakdawala is an instructional game collection that analyzes Bent Larsen’s play through a move-by-move commentary format.
The book presents selected games from Larsen’s career, explaining each move in detail to reveal his distinctive, creative, unorthodox, and fighting style of play.
A major focus is on Larsen’s use of unusual opening choices, dynamic piece play, and willingness to take strategic risks to unbalance positions.
Lakdawala highlights key themes such as imaginative middlegame planning, initiative-based attacks, and practical decision-making in complex positions.
The annotations also explore the reasoning behind Larsen’s unconventional ideas, helping readers understand when creativity can be more important than strict adherence to theory.
